President H.E. Abdirahman Mohamed Abdilahi Irro of the Republic of Somaliland held a pivotal quarterly meeting today with the Directors General of the nation’s Ministries and Independent Agencies, focusing on enhancing operational efficiency and public service delivery.

The meeting centered on reviewing the progress of critical tasks, staffing, service provision, and adherence to working hours. President Irro underscored the importance of each Ministry and Agency conducting thorough assessments of their achievements, pending tasks, planned objectives, and challenges requiring immediate attention.

In a call for stronger governance, the President urged the Directors General to foster greater cooperation and trust in their administrative roles. “Quality service delivery, administrative transparency, and accountability are non-negotiable,” he stated, emphasizing the need for alignment with Somaliland’s national development priorities.

Key remarks were delivered by prominent figures, including the Chairperson of the Directors General Council and Director General of the Ministry of Water Development Eng Gaas, alongside counterparts from the Ministry of the Presidency, Ministry of Aviation and Airport Development, Ministry of Agricultural Development, Good Governance Commission, and the Civil Service Agency.

The officials expressed gratitude for the President’s trust and leadership, pledging to advance the government’s vision of unity and action. They committed to prioritizing decentralized governance in regions and districts, improving community services, and fostering stronger ties between the government and Somaliland’s citizens to bolster public confidence.

President Irro concluded the meeting by urging the Directors General to uphold integrity in their duties, ensure fairness for their staff, and maintain strict adherence to working hours. He stressed the importance of delivering services tailored to citizens’ needs and maintaining financial accountability while working collectively toward the government’s overarching goals.

This meeting signals Somaliland’s continued push for effective governance and citizen-focused development under President Irro’s leadership.
